| * <p> |
| * There are also functions that provide easy migration from C/POSIX functions |
| * like isblank(). Their use is generally discouraged because the C/POSIX |
| * standards do not define their semantics beyond the ASCII range, which means |
| * that different implementations exhibit very different behavior. |
| * Instead, Unicode properties should be used directly. |
| * </p> |
| * <p> |
| * There are also only a few, broad C/POSIX character classes, and they tend |
| * to be used for conflicting purposes. For example, the "isalpha()" class |
| * is sometimes used to determine word boundaries, while a more sophisticated |
| * approach would at least distinguish initial letters from continuation |
| * characters (the latter including combining marks). |
| * (In ICU, BreakIterator is the most sophisticated API for word boundaries.) |
| * Another example: There is no "istitle()" class for titlecase characters. |
| * </p> |
| * <p> |
| * ICU 3.4 and later provides API access for all twelve C/POSIX character classes. |
| * ICU implements them according to the Standard Recommendations in |
| * Annex C: Compatibility Properties of UTS #18 Unicode Regular Expressions |
| * (http://www.unicode.org/reports/tr18/#Compatibility_Properties). |
| * </p> |
| * <p> |
| * API access for C/POSIX character classes is as follows: |
| * - alpha: isUAlphabetic(c) or h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.ALPHABETIC) |
| * - lower: isULowercase(c) or h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.LOWERCASE) |
| * - upper: isUUppercase(c) or h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.UPPERCASE) |
| * - punct: ((1<<getType(c)) & ((1<<DASH_PUNCTUATION)|(1<<START_PUNCTUATION)|(1<<END_PUNCTUATION)|(1<<CONNECTOR_PUNCTUATION)|(1<<OTHER_PUNCTUATION)|(1<<INITIAL_PUNCTUATION)|(1<<FINAL_PUNCTUATION)))!=0 |
| * - digit: isDigit(c) or getType(c)==DECIMAL_DIGIT_NUMBER |
| * - xdigit: h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.POSIX_XDIGIT) |
| * - alnum: h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.POSIX_ALNUM) |
| * - space: isUWhiteSpace(c) or h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.WHITE_SPACE) |
| * - blank: h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.POSIX_BLANK) |
| * - cntrl: getType(c)==CONTROL |
| * - graph: h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.POSIX_GRAPH) |
| * - print: hasBinaryProperty(c, UProperty.POSIX_PRINT) |
| * </p> |
| * <p> |
| * The C/POSIX character classes are also available in UnicodeSet patterns, |
| * using patterns like [:graph:] or \p{graph}. |
| * </p> |
| * <p> |
| * Note: There are several ICU (and Java) whitespace functions. |
| * Comparison: |
| * - isUWhiteSpace=UCHAR_WHITE_SPACE: Unicode White_Space property; |
| * most of general categories "Z" (separators) + most whitespace ISO controls |
| * (including no-break spaces, but excluding IS1..IS4 and ZWSP) |
| * - isWhitespace: Java isWhitespace; Z + whitespace ISO controls but excluding no-break spaces |
| * - isSpaceChar: just Z (including no-break spaces) |
| * </p> |
